CVE-2018-17197
A carefully crafted or corrupt sqlite file can cause an infinite loop in Apache Tika's SQLite3Parser in versions 1.8-1.19.1 of Apache Tika...

Apache Tika Command Injection (CVE-2018-1335)
A command injection vulnerability exists in Apache Tika. The vulnerability is due to improper validation of the HTTP requests. Successful exploitation of this vulnerability could allow a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code...

Apache Tika allows Java code execution for serialized objects embedded in MATLAB files
Apache Tika before 1.14 allows Java code execution for serialized objects embedded in MATLAB files. The issue exists because Tika invokes JMatIO to do native deserialization...

Apache Tika does not properly initialize the XML parser or choose handlers
Apache Tika before 1.13 does not properly initialize the XML parser or choose handlers, which might allow remote attackers to conduct XML External Entity XXE attacks via vectors involving 1 spreadsheets in OOXML files and 2 XMP metadata in PDF and other file formats, a related issue to...

GHSA-9R24-GP44-H3PM Command injection in org.apache.tika:tika-core
From Apache Tika versions 1.7 to 1.17, clients could send carefully crafted headers to tika-server that could be used to inject commands into the command line of the server running tika-server. This vulnerability only affects those running tika-server on a server that is open to untrusted clients...
